Deciding on Materials for Energy-Efficient Sliding Doors
Determining the suitable materials for energy-conscious sliding doors is essential to optimizing their functionality and visual allure. Frequent options include vinyl, fiberglass, and wood, each offering distinct benefits. Vinyl is noted for its exceptional thermal qualities and low maintenance needs, making it a popular selection. Fiberglass delivers durability and resistance to warping, while also supplying good energy efficiency. Wood, though visually attractive, often demands substantial upkeep and may demand added thermal protection to meet energy standards.
The choice of glazing also serves as a crucial role. Multi-pane glass with Low-E coatings can significantly reduce heat transfer, improving energy efficiency. Additionally, selecting window frames with thermal barriers can further improve thermal insulation. Ultimately, a careful evaluation of material options, paired with energy-efficient features, guarantees that sliding door systems not only enhance the home's aesthetic appeal but also contribute to reduced energy expenses and greater comfort.
How to Set up Energy-Efficient Sliding Doors
Installing sliding doors that are energy-efficient demands meticulous planning and execution to guarantee optimal performance and durability. The initial step involves measuring the existing door frame accurately to ensure a proper fit. The old door must be removed with caution to avoid damaging the surrounding structure. Once the space is ready, the new sliding door should be set into the frame. Confirming that the door is even and plumb is vital; shims may be needed for adjustments. After the door is secured, insulating properly around the frame is key to prevent air leaks. Including weather stripping in the installation enhances energy efficiency. Lastly, check the door’s operation to confirm smooth sliding and secure locks. This systematic approach not only boosts energy efficiency but also enhances the visual appeal and function of the home.
Best Methods for Caring for Sliding Doors
Proper installation of energy-efficient sliding doors establishes the foundation for their durability, but ongoing maintenance is just as crucial to confirm optimal operation. Frequent cleaning is essential; tracks should be emptied of dust and particles to avoid blockage and ensure seamless operation. Homeowners insightful guide should examine the weatherstripping regularly for any wear or damage, replacing it as needed to maintain thermal performance.
Coating the cylinders and tracks with a silicone-based spray helps improve performance and reduce wear. It is also advisable to check the doors’ positioning, as poor alignment may cause gaps, which compromises energy efficiency. In addition, checking the glass for cracks or breaks can help prevent further damage and energy loss. By adhering to these best practices, homeowners can extend the life of their sliding doors and boost their energy-saving advantages. What Do Typical Energy-Saving Sliding Doors Price?
The typical pricing of energy-efficient sliding doors typically covers $800 to $3,000, depending on materials, size, and installation. Homeowners ought to consider future financial benefits on energy bills when assessing their investment in these doors.

Can I Retrofit Existing Doors for Better Energy Efficiency?
Upgrading current doors for improved energy efficiency is possible through weatherstripping, adding insulation, or fitting energy-efficient glass. These upgrades can strengthen insulation and reduce energy loss, making older doors highly efficient without total replacement.
